【问题标题】:Formik + Yup - Show error as user is typing inFormik + Yup - 用户输入时显示错误
【发布时间】:2020-08-20 07:24:48
【问题描述】:

我有一个电子邮件字段,并且在用户输入时验证其唯一性,即用户输入的电子邮件是否可用。目前,我只在用户失去该字段的焦点(onBlur)时收到错误消息,但我希望 formik 在用户输入时显示错误。我已经读过在失去该字段的焦点时显示错误是“默认值” ' formik 的行为,但我希望也许有办法实现我想要的?

【问题讨论】:

    标签: javascript forms validation formik yup


    【解决方案1】:

    您可以使用 Formik 的 validateOnChange 属性来触发每个更改事件的验证

    详情请见here

    【讨论】:

    • 我相信它们都默认设置为 true。改变他们的价值观对我不起作用。
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2022-07-28
    • 2021-03-10
    • 2020-10-14
    • 2020-08-06
    • 1970-01-01
    • 2019-11-12
    • 2021-02-09
    相关资源
    最近更新 更多